KinderCare creates an environment where children are safe, nurtured, loved and encouraged to learn.
Our education department uses current research to create an exclusive, proven curriculum for our teachers so you know that your child is getting the advantage of a large network of educational resources and the best care available.
KinderCare's exclusive educational programs provide unlimited opportunities for the development of the whole child.
There's a unique curriculum for every age level, centered around developmentally appropriate and fun activities that help children develop physically, intellectually, emotionally and socially.
In the classroom and on the playground, age-appropriate concepts are integrated into all aspects of play.
Sometimes it's through a game. Another time it's through a song.
Other times it's through exploration in our Discovery Areas. By providing children with activities that match their developmental needs and abilities, learning occurs easily and naturally.
